In the vast and rugged wilderness of Alaska, a story of a tragic accident unfolded in the summer of 2000. On August 7th of that year, 35-year-old Naomi Sugiura, a female of Asian descent, was enjoying a canoe trip in the scenic Katmai National Park and Preserve. The park, located on the Alaska Peninsula, is a place of breathtaking beauty, known for its volcanoes, vast lakes, and abundant wildlife.
